.10 Best things to do in Covent Garden
1. Convent Garden Market

The market is one of the best things to do in Covent garden. Here, you can buy some of the best handmade and artisanal goods in all of London. Fashion, art, and home decor are all sold under the famous glass roof. This is the place to go if you want to see how a market works or buy some gifts.

2. Neal’s Yard
The West End is known for being artsy, and Neal’s Yard, a small but lively alley of unique, organic shops in the middle of Covent Garden, is a great example of this.

5. London Transport Museum

You may know that London’s Underground system changed the way people traveled in cities, but there is a lot more to London’s transportation history than meets the eye. At the London Transport Museum, you can find out all about it.

7. Somerset House

If you like art and exhibitions, you should go to Somerset House to see some of the most famous installations and creative works in all of Europe, arguably one of the best things to do in Covent Garden if you are an art lover.
8. Rules Restaurant

There are lots of places to eat in Covent Garden, so whether you want Indian afternoon tea in London or a traditional English fry-up, you’ll find it. But Rules, London’s oldest restaurant, is in Covent Garden, so if that’s not a reason to go, we don’t know what is.
9. Cecil Court Cecil Court

Step back in time to London during the time of Charles Dickens by going to Cecil Court, which is full of charming bookshops that haven’t changed since the 17th century. Visiting this court is one of the best things to do in Covent Garden.
10. K2 Telephone Boxes

When you think of London, you might picture red phone booths, but it can be hard to find them in the city these days. So, go to the Kiosk Two telephone box installation, where there are five of these famous red boxes that have changed how the rest of the world sees Britain.
